Best cities to move to for 2022 (Jacksonville, Mesa, Columbus and Boulder).

Jacksonville, Florida. You should consider this city if you’re seeking employment in the tech industry. The projected job growth in the area by 2022 is 7.7 percent and the city’s population is also expected to increase, following the pattern from previous years. In case you’re not happy with only scoring a job, don’t worry because you’ll find about 22 miles of beaches and plenty more things to enjoy in this coastal city. Artists hub here is combined with farmers market, so you’ll get to enjoy some delicious bites, while listening to live music and supporting local artists. What more could one want?
If the tech industry doesn’t interest you and you’d rather move somewhere with other sectors thriving you should consider Mesa, Arizona. For those looking to spend as many sunny days enjoying the outdoors, this place makes a great choice like most other places on our list. Mesa is expected to see more jobs and population growth in the next couple of years. Check this place out especially if you’re in the investment and manufacturing sectors, you’ll find low taxes and lower than the nation’s average cost of living, while not having to look far for an outdoor retreat and getting to enjoy almost 300 clear days a year.
Columbus, Ohio. The reason why you should consider this place, is that it’s one of the fastest growing cities in the states and here’s proof of that. Columbus had an increase of almost 11 percent in population and an amazing 14% job growth in the past eight years, the cost of living is 98.8 compared to the national average which is 100, so it’s also an affordable option to consider when looking for a new place this year. Boulder, Colorado. Boulder has been dubbed the city nestled between the mountains and it’s known for its stunning nature, outdoor activities, vibrant downtown, as well as its community’s laid-back attitude. This intriguing place is often ranked high among the best places to live in the U.S and once you visit, you’ll easily understand why living in America’s foodiest town comes at a steep price, so do check if your budget can handle moving to this amazing place. The quality of life in Boulder is incredible. There are plenty of fascinating things and activities to do and foods to eat. Typically, Boulder has a small-town feeling but is filled with big-city amenities, making it one of the most in-demand cities around. With a standard cost of living index of 167.4, the city is considered happier, friendly, and more relaxed, with a high quality of life. Although Boulder is relatively expensive to live in, it’s worth the price.
